Sudan’s El-Fasher Faces Accountability Demands Amidst Violence and Political Shifts
The international community is demanding accountability following reports of widespread killings and sexual violence in El-Fasher, Sudan, as the city grapples with the aftermath of its seizure by the paramilitary Rapid Support Forces (RSF). Concerns are mounting for the safety of civilians remaining in the city and those seeking to evacuate.
El-Fasher Crisis Deepens: UN Calls for Justice
Tom Fletcher, the United Nations’ leading humanitarian official, has unequivocally stated that those responsible for atrocities committed in El-Fasher must be held accountable. His statement comes after the RSF took control of the city over the weekend, triggering a surge in violence and a humanitarian crisis. Fletcher emphasized the urgent need to ensure safe passage for individuals wishing to leave El-Fasher, while simultaneously guaranteeing the protection of those who remain.
The leader of the RSF has announced an internal investigation into alleged violations carried out by his troops. However, this declaration has been met with skepticism, particularly in light of accusations that RSF soldiers massacred hundreds of civilians at a hospital in El-Fasher on Tuesday. The RSF leader has vehemently denied these accusations.
Understanding the Conflict in Sudan
The ongoing conflict in Sudan, which erupted in April 2023, pits the Sudanese Armed Forces (SAF) against the RSF. The power struggle between General Abdel Fattah al-Burhan, the head of the SAF, and General Mohamed Hamdan Dagalo, the commander of the RSF, stems from disagreements over the integration of the RSF into the regular army and the future direction of Sudan’s transition to civilian rule. El-Fasher, the capital of North Darfur, holds significant strategic importance due to its location and its role as a hub for humanitarian aid. The RSF’s capture of the city represents a major setback for the SAF and raises fears of further escalation in the Darfur region, which has a history of ethnic violence. The situation is particularly dire for civilians, who are caught in the crossfire and face a severe lack of access to essential services.
